Maine ancillary health service organizations

There are 61ancillary health care service organizations in Maine. Combined, these Mainerancillary health service organizationsemploy 1,235 people, earn more than $142 million in revenue each year, and have assets of $124 million.

Key takeaways for revenue stats:
  • Large organizations like NorDx, LifeFlight of Maine, Delta Ambulance, United Ambulance, and Med-Care earn the majority of revenues among nonprofits in Maine ancillary health service organizations.
  • Organizations with less than $1 million in revenue account for 6.5% of combined nonprofit revenues, whereas organizations in Maine ancillary health service organizations with more than $100 million account for 0.0% of nonprofit earnings.

Methodology: Cause IQ mines all tax-exempt organizations that file a Form 990, Form 990-EZ, or Form 990-PF with the IRS. We collect and aggregate this information from OCR'd paper taxreturns, XML e-file taxreturns, IRS-provided extract, the Business Master File, and Cause IQ secret sauce for data cleaning, categorization, classification, analytics, etc.
This category corresponds to the "E60: Health Support Services" National Taxonomy of Exempt Entities (NTEE) code. Cause IQ determines NTEEs for organizations by its own internally-developed secret-sauce algorithms.
